Problems with alcohol are a common occurrence in today’s culture and can range in intensity from strong cravings to alcohol abuse to alcoholism itself, the most severe. Alcoholism occurs when a person becomes completely dependent on ‘the drink’ to get them through daily life, even at the cost of any problems that may arise, and is sometimes indicative of a physical addiction as well.
There are many reasons why people drink. Social situations and psychological factors are the most common. However, those with a family history of excessive drinking are also at a high risk for becoming alcoholics themselves, due to a genetic predisposition to the disease.
An addiction to alcohol can take its toll on a person’s life, causing problems at work or with friends and family. It is a debilitating disorder that can lead to various health conditions, such as:
• sleep deprivation
• blackouts and/or confusion
• mood swings (varying from depression to violent outbursts)
• anemia
• seizures
• liver and other organ damage
Even if an individual suffering from alcoholism genuinely wants to stop drinking, quitting can be very difficult. Withdrawal symptoms can range from mild to severe (requiring medical help) and are sometimes a reason many continue drinking. For those who do go into a detoxification program, it is often recommended to treat the anxiety associated with withdrawal symptoms.
